Position Brief
SAGA Realty and Construction, an innovative and growing construction and realty firm is looking for a Purchasing and Estimating Officer who would be responsible for evaluating vendors, negotiating contracts and preparing reports (e.g. on orders and costs). The ideal candidate should have good knowledge of market research and solid analytical skills to identify the most profitable offers in order to project and control construction costs.
Responsibilities
Prepares work to be accomplished by gathering information and requirements; setting priorities.
Prepare construction budget by studying home plans; updating specifications; identifying and projecting costs for each elevation.
Obtain bids from vendors and subcontractors by specifying materials; identifying qualified subcontractors; negotiating price.
Maintain cost keys and price masters by updating information.
Resolve cost discrepancies by collecting and analyzing information.
Research potential vendors
Compare and evaluate offers from vendors
Negotiate contract terms of agreement and pricing
Track orders and ensure timely delivery
Review quality of purchased products
Enter order details (e.g. vendors, quantities, prices) into internal databases
Maintain updated records of purchased products, delivery information and invoices
Prepare reports on purchases, including cost analysis.
